One more update for tonight. I pulled a plug to check for spark. Dyna S for the win. Even with a weak battery and the bike turning over slowly I'm getting a nice blue spark. Also tried the poor man's compression test. Plug the hole with a finger and hit the starter. It makes good enough compression to start. I don't care to run a proper compression test. Frankly I don't want to know what the number is right now. Good enough to start is good enough for me. I have started motors with way less compression than this thing makes.
